Crushed concrete fines are a recycled concrete aggregate routinely used as a base for brick patio pavers, roads, parking areas, and building foundations. The spec on this material is 3/8 inch and minus down to a powder, with the bulk consisting of powder. Crushed concrete fines compact very well making them an ideal subbase material.

Decomposed granite is a finely crushed and weathered rock. Decomposed granite compacts down tight. It has rock chips and finer material that can be as fine as sand. This is the nature of the decomposed granite and is what gives it the tight compaction. This material gives you a way to create spaces that are not only beautiful but functional ...

Stabilising Fines and Crushed Limestone. If you are planning on using our fines or crushed limestone for paths, driveways or patio areas then you might consider adding a stabilising agent to aid compaction and reduce erosion. We can stabilise our fines and crushed limestone with either Soilbond or cement depending on the application.
